A man has been charged with attempted murder in relation to a stabbing in Aberfan on Tuesday. 28 year old Daniel Mihai Popescu of Merthyr Tydfil was taken into police custody and charged after police were called to an incident on Moy Road on Tuesday morning. Eyewitnesses say the 29 year old victim was pregnant.

Former Prime Minister Boris Johnson has said it was a mistake for Wales and other devolved UK nations to have different messaging on covid, despite calling it their natural and proper right. Johnson and some of his former colleagues have said that needs to change in the future, something Mark Drakeford disagrees with.

Members of the Senedd have hit out at Pontin’s owners after their Prestatyn site closed with immediate effect earlier on this week. Staff at the site allegedly only found out about the decision, which could cost up to 200 jobs, via social media.
